引言
在当今的网络环境中,DNS(域名系统)扮演着至关重要的角色。它不仅仅是将域名解析为IP地址的系统,更是确保网络服务正常运行的关键组件之一。在众多云服务提供商中,Linode以其强大的性能和灵活的配置选项而闻名。本文将深入探讨Linode的DNS管理,包括如何设置、配置以及常见问题的解决方案。
什么是Linode DNS?
Linode DNS是Linode提供的域名解析服务。它允许用户管理其域名并将其指向Linode的服务器或其他互联网资源。通过Linode的DNS管理界面,用户可以轻松设置和更新DNS记录,包括A记录、CNAME记录、MX记录等。
Linode DNS的优势
- 高可用性:Linode提供的DNS服务具有高度的冗余性,确保用户的网站始终可用。
- 易于管理:用户可以通过Linode的控制面板轻松管理和配置DNS记录,操作简单直观。
- 全球CDN:Linode的DNS服务集成了全球内容分发网络(CDN),提升了网站的访问速度。
如何在Linode上设置DNS
步骤一:创建域名
- 登录Linode账户,进入Domain管理页面。
- 点击“Add a Domain”,输入你的域名,并点击确认。
步骤二:添加DNS记录
- 在已创建的域名下,点击“Add a Record”。
- 选择记录类型(A、CNAME、MX等),并输入相应的值。
- 设置TTL(生存时间),然后保存记录。
常见的DNS记录类型
- A记录:将域名映射到IPv4地址。
- AAAA记录:将域名映射到IPv6地址。
- CNAME记录:将一个域名别名指向另一个域名。
- MX记录:指定邮件服务器的地址。
Linode DNS配置的注意事项
- DNS传播时间:在更新DNS记录后,可能需要数小时甚至48小时才能完全传播。
- TTL设置:根据需要合理设置TTL,以平衡更新频率与缓存效果。
- 避免冲突:确保没有重复的DNS记录,否则会导致解析错误。
如何解决Linode DNS问题
常见问题及解决方案
- 问题一:DNS解析失败
解决方案:检查域名的DNS记录是否正确配置,并确保域名已指向正确的Linode IP地址。 - 问题二:DNS记录未更新
解决方案:确认TTL设置,必要时可以尝试清除本地DNS缓存。 - 问题三:无法访问网站
解决方案:检查域名解析是否正常,使用命令行工具如dig
或nslookup
进行排查。
Linode DNS的安全性
在使用Linode的DNS服务时,确保开启以下安全措施:
- DNSSEC:为你的DNS添加安全性,防止DNS欺骗攻击。
- SSL证书:使用HTTPS协议加密用户与服务器之间的通信。
- 定期审查DNS记录:定期检查DNS记录,删除不必要的记录以减少潜在风险。
结论
Linode DNS管理是一项强大的功能,它使用户能够灵活控制自己的域名和网络资源。通过正确的配置和管理,用户可以充分利用Linode的高可用性和快速性能。希望本文对您在Linode上设置和管理DNS有所帮助!
常见问题解答(FAQ)
1. 如何使用Linode DNS?
您可以在Linode的控制面板中添加和管理DNS记录。只需登录Linode,创建一个域名并添加所需的DNS记录即可。
2. Linode DNS支持哪些记录类型?
Linode DNS支持多种记录类型,包括A、AAAA、CNAME、MX、TXT和NS记录。
3. 更新DNS记录后多久生效?
更新DNS记录后,通常需要几分钟到48小时的时间才能完全生效,具体取决于TTL设置。
4. 如何排查DNS解析问题?
您可以使用命令行工具如dig
和nslookup
检查DNS解析是否正常。检查DNS记录设置和TTL是排查问题的关键。
5. Linode的DNS服务安全性如何?
Linode的DNS服务提供了DNSSEC支持,并且可以与SSL证书一起使用,以确保域名解析的安全性。定期审查DNS记录是保持安全的好方法。
正文完